{site_name}

{site_name}

🌜 搜索

在 PHP 中,pg_trace 函数用于在 PostgreSQL 数据库中启用或禁用跟踪功能

php 𝄐 0
php pgsql,php pgsql 总提示密码不正确,php pgsql扩展,php pgsql 大字符串 提交,php pgsql 长字符串 提交,phpPgAdmin
在 PHP 中,pg_trace 函数用于在 PostgreSQL 数据库中启用或禁用跟踪功能。跟踪功能可以捕获和记录数据库操作的详细信息,如查询语句、执行计划、执行时间等。

使用 pg_trace 函数时,需要传递两个参数:跟踪状态和跟踪日志文件名。跟踪状态可以是以下值之一:
- 0:禁用跟踪功能
- 1:启用跟踪功能但不输出到日志文件
- 2:启用跟踪功能并输出到日志文件

例如,以下代码将启用跟踪功能并将消息输出到名为 "postgres.log" 的日志文件中:
php
pg_trace(2, 'postgres.log');


在跟踪功能启用后,所有执行的数据库操作将被记录到指定的日志文件中。您可以通过打开日志文件来查看记录的详细信息。

请注意,使用 pg_trace 函数可能会对性能产生影响,并且应仅在调试或性能分析阶段使用。在生产环境中,请确保禁用跟踪功能。